How much battery storage will a solar system have in 2023?
While approximately 12% of photovoltaic (PV) systems installed on homes and businesses included battery storage in 2023, the Solar Energy Industries Association estimates that this rate will rise to 28% by 2028.
How much does a solar battery cost in 2025?
In 2025, a typical solar battery installation costs $9,000–$18,000 before incentives and $6,000–$12,000 after credits. By 2026, continued cost declines are expected to make home energy storage even more accessible, with prices averaging 8–12% lower than current levels.
How much does a solar battery installation cost?
Labor and overhead: With professional help, solar battery installations can also include $2,000 to $3,500 in labor and overhead costs. The cost of solar energy storage has decreased dramatically since 2010, and battery systems are now cheaper and more widely accessible than ever.
How much is a solar battery tax credit?
Most solar battery installations will earn a federal tax credit of about $4,500! Aside from the tax credit, utilities and states are opening more battery programs. Some are rebates that reduce the upfront cost of a battery, like California's SGIP program.
